Facts about Red Sun No. 5

Who wrote Red Sun No. 5 lyrics?


Red Sun No. 5 is written by Michael Owen Pallett.

When was Red Sun No. 5 released?


Red Sun No. 5 is first released on January 11, 2010 as part of Owen Pallett's album "Heartland" which includes 12 tracks in total. This song is the 3rd track on this album.

Which genre is Red Sun No. 5?


Red Sun No. 5 falls under the genre Electronic.
